21 Oct 2019 ... Chevron has four joint ventures with PDVSA in Venezuela, which between them produce about 200,000 barrels of crude per day (b/d) — more than a ...

The United States eased those sanctions in November 2022 when OFAC granted waivers to Chevron so it could resume exporting crude oil from its joint venture operations in Venezuela to U.S. Gulf Coast refineries, which restarted in January 2023. Refineries on the U.S. Gulf Coast are well-suited to take the kind of heavy crude oil …
